Get notified when packages are built

A new feature has been added. FreshPorts already tracks package built by the FreeBSD project. This information is displayed on each port page. You can now get an email when FreshPorts notices a new package is available for something on one of your watch lists. However, you must opt into that. Click on Report Subscriptions on the right, and New Package Notification box, and click on Update.

Finally, under Watch Lists, click on ABI Package Subscriptions to select your ABI (e.g. FreeBSD:14:amd64) & package set (latest/quarterly) combination for a given watch list. This is what FreshPorts will look for.

graphics/kf5-kimageformats: fix pkg-plist

The option has been renamed from LIBHEIF to HEIF and %%LIBHEIF%% in
pkg-plist must therefore be chnaged to %%HEIF%%.

Importing KDE Frameworks into the ports tree (required for newer KDE Desktop and
Applications)

KDE Frameworks is a collection of libraries and software frameworks by KDE
that serve as technological foundation for KDE Plasma 5 and KDE Applications
distributed under the GNU Lesser General Public License (LGPL) [1].

The work is based on what we have in the KDE testing repo [2].

This is the next big step in updating the KDE Desktop and its Applications
to anything less dusty.

With this change, `USES=kde:5` is now a valid option. Ports that need to depend
on KDE Framework can now set:
	USES=kde:5
	USE_KDE=<framework1> <framework2> ... <frameworkX>
